The E6S35AV HP 2-Ports 10/100/1000Base-T PCI Express x 1 Network Interface Card Adapter provides dual gigabit Ethernet connectivity through a compact PCIe x1 interface. It fits into server or workstation systems to deliver consistent network performance across multiple speed tiers without demanding extensive resources. |

| Brand | HP |
| Technical Information | |
|---|---|
| Product Type | Network Interface Card |
| Data Rate (Speed) | 1GbE |
| Data Center Bridging | No |
| Number of Ports | 2-Port (Dual) |
| OS Compatibility | RHEL, VMware ESXi |
| Offload Support | PXE Boot, Wake-on-LAN (WoL), Jumbo Frames |
| Bracket Height | Both Brackets Included |
| Connectivity & Physical | |
|---|---|
| Form Factor | Standard PCIe Card |
| Port Type | RJ-45 (Copper) |
| Cabling Type | Cat6 |
| Weight | 3.00 |
| Condition | Refurbished |
| Miscellaneous | |
|---|---|
| Assembly Required | No |
| Compliance Standards | WEEE, RoHS, CE, FCC |
